Compare Roselle to Aurora
This post compares Roselle, Illinois to Aurora, Illinois across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Roselle (village) | Aurora (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 22,925 | 200,946 |
Income (median) | $53,064 | $44,325 |
Home Value (median) | $241,800 | $170,800 |
White | 83% | 56% |
Black | 4% | 10% |
Asian | 7% | 8% |
With Kids | 35% | 45% |
Age (median) | 39 | 32 |
Rentals | 23% | 35% |
Questions and Answers:
Q: Which is more populated, Roselle or Aurora?
A: Roselle has a much smaller population count than Aurora: 22925 compared with 200946 total people.
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Roselle or in Aurora?
A: Incomes are on average higher in Roselle.
Q: Are homes more expensive in Roselle or Aurora?
A: Homes tend to be more expensive in Roselle.
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Aurora does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 23% for Roselle versus 35% for Aurora.
